Overview
Forex Financial Services was founded in 2008 and is headquartered in Australia, while stoxmarket was established in 2010 and is based in Dubai. Forex Financial Services holds licences including Australian Securities and investment Commission (ASIC), while stoxmarket is regulated by Financial Conduct Authority (FCA) among others. Forex Financial Services serves 10,000+ clients worldwide; stoxmarket has 10,000+. The minimum deposit is $2500 at Forex Financial Services and $250 at stoxmarket.
| Feature | Forex Financial Services | stoxmarket |
|---|---|---|
| Min. Deposit | $2500 | $250 |
| Regulation | Australian Securities and investment Commission (ASIC) | Financial Conduct Authority (FCA), Australian Securities and Investment Commission (ASIC), Dubai Financial Services Authority (DFSA), Pepperstone Markets Limited is incorporated in The Bahamas (number 177174 B), Licensed by the Securities Commission of The Bahamas (SCB) number SIA-F313 |
| Founded | 2008 | 2010 |
| Country | Australia | Dubai |
| Clients | 10,000+ | 10,000+ |
Fees
Fees are a critical factor when choosing between Forex Financial Services and stoxmarket, directly affecting your bottom line as a trader. stoxmarket has a lower barrier to entry with a minimum deposit of $250 (vs $2500 at Forex Financial Services). Neither broker charges withdrawal fees. stoxmarket applies inactivity fees on dormant accounts; Forex Financial Services does not. Forex Financial Services charges deposit fees; stoxmarket does not. The two brokers are broadly comparable on fee structure.
| Feature | Forex Financial Services | stoxmarket |
|---|---|---|
| Min. Deposit | $2500 | $250 |
| Withdrawal Fees | No | No |
| Inactivity Fees | No | Yes |
| Deposit Fees | Yes | No |
| CFD Fees | No | No |

Deposits & Withdrawals
Convenient deposit and withdrawal options reduce friction for traders, especially important when managing positions across time zones. Forex Financial Services accepts 2 of the tracked payment methods (bank transfer, credit/debit card), while stoxmarket supports 5 (bank transfer, credit/debit card, PayPal, Skrill, Neteller). stoxmarket uniquely supports PayPal and Skrill and Neteller among the two brokers. stoxmarket scores higher on deposit and withdrawal flexibility.
| Feature | Forex Financial Services | stoxmarket |
|---|---|---|
| Bank Transfer | Yes | Yes |
| Credit Card | Yes | Yes |
| PayPal | No | Yes |
| Skrill | No | Yes |
| Neteller | No | Yes |
